BTC992 PRAY GOODY

For high voice and piano
Composition date: ca. 1945-46
Genre: Solo vocal
Text: Kane O'Hara

From Midas, Dublin 1761.

Duration: 2'

Notes

The tune for 'Pray Goody' came from Act I, scene 3 of O'Hara's Midas (see text note) and it was also the 'Fairy dance' in Henry Woodward's pantomime Queen Mab (1705) (Act I, sc. 3 in the 1761 version). The music for this pantomime was attributed to 'The Society of the temple of Apollo', a pseudonym for Charles Burney.
